Why Study Civil Engineering in the UK?
Civil engineering programs in the UK stand out for several compelling reasons. The UK has a rich history of engineering achievements. Think of the Victorian-era marvels like the London Underground or the Clifton Suspension Bridge. Studying in the UK means you're walking in the footsteps of engineering giants, guys! Plus, UK universities consistently rank high in global rankings, making a degree from there a valuable asset. These programs usually emphasize a blend of theoretical knowledge and practical application. You'll get your hands dirty with real-world projects, simulations, and site visits, ensuring you're not just book-smart but also job-ready. Many courses are accredited by professional bodies like the Institution of Civil Engineers (ICE), which is a massive boost for your career prospects, opening doors to chartered engineer status. The UK's diverse and multicultural environment provides a fantastic setting for international students, offering exposure to different perspectives and approaches to engineering challenges. Civil engineering is a global field, and studying in the UK prepares you to work effectively in international teams and projects. What to Consider When Choosing a University
Choosing the right university is a big decision. Here are a few things to keep in mind:
Career Prospects for Civil Engineers
Civil engineering graduates are in high demand, with a wide range of career opportunities available. You could work on designing and constructing buildings, bridges, roads, railways, and other infrastructure projects. Other options include environmental engineering, geotechnical engineering, and project management. With experience, you could become a chartered engineer, leading your own projects and teams. The demand for civil engineers is expected to grow in the coming years, driven by population growth, urbanization, and the need for sustainable infrastructure. This makes civil engineering a promising career path for those who are passionate about building a better future.
